READING AUTHENTIC LITERATURE AS A MEANS OF INCREASING MOTIVATION TO LEARN A FOREIGN LANGUAGE

ABSTRACT

The article examines the role of reading authentic literature in increasing the motivation of students to learn a foreign language. The results of foreign and Kazakhstani studies on the impact of reading artistic texts on the development of language skills and educational motivation are analyzed. Examples of books that may be of interest to students when learning a foreign language are also given. It is concluded that the use of authentic literary works contributes to the formation of a sustainable interest in learning the language, expanding the vocabulary and developing the cultural competence of students.

In the modern world, knowledge of foreign languages   is an important condition for successful communication and professional development. But the process of learning a foreign language takes a lot of time and requires effort. But one of the main tasks for teachers and students remains to maintain motivation. The main problem of low motivation among students is traditional exercises and adapted texts from textbooks, which for the most part is divorced from reality and are perceived as artificial. In this regard, teachers are looking for effective methods that can increase interest in learning the language. One of these methods is the use of authentic literature in the learning process. reading authentic literature is a powerful tool that can increase motivation to learn a foreign language, and this material can always be selected individually, focusing on the interests and age characteristics of students.

Authentic literature consists of texts (newspaper articles, blogs, excerpts from works of fiction, advertisements, podcasts) created by native speakers for native speakers and not specially adapted for educational purposes. Reading such works helps students to get acquainted with the real language, culture and thinking features of native speakers.

Many foreign researchers emphasize the significant role of reading fiction in the study of a foreign language. One of the most famous theories is the concept of extensive reading, according to which students read a large number of texts according to their interest. For example, a meta-analysis of studies on the study of a foreign language showed a positive effect of extensive reading on the development of various language competencies and an increase in interest in reading [1]. Results from other studies demonstrate that students show greater motivation to read if they can choose books that suit their interests. In one of the studies, about 77.5% of students noted that their motivation increases when the study materials coincide with their personal interests [2]. Thus, foreign studies confirm that the use of authentic literary texts can significantly increase the interest of students in learning a foreign language.

Kazakhstan also pays attention to the use of authentic texts when teaching foreign languages. Domestic researchers note that reading original literary works contributes to the formation of the communicative competence of students and the expansion of their cultural horizons. For example, in their work Abdykhalykova A.M., Beisembaeva J.A. investigated the use of digital authentic texts (news, sites, media) and showed that this material increases the interest and motivation of students, helps to acquaint students with real culture and language environment [3].

In addition, the use of interesting and modern works helps to make the learning process funnier.  When a student understands a real article, a promotional poster, or an excerpt from a favorite novel, they feel an immediate connection to a living language. As noted in the study of A.Z. Urazbaeva, A.G. Turgumbaeva the impact on students of authentic texts increases their cognitive involvement and gives a feeling of involvement in real culture, which significantly increases self-efficacy [4].

To increase motivation to learn a foreign language, it is important to select books that correspond to the age and interests of students, that is, literature that can evoke emotions. Laughter, sadness, sympathy for the characters or surprise at the plot twist all create a strong emotional connection with language. Emotions, in turn, are a powerful catalyst for memory and motivation “I want to read further to find out how it will end” , which means that the language learns "along the way," naturally.

Working with authentic literature, there is not just a retelling, but a process of integration into personal experience. When, after reading, students are offered tasks like: "What would you do in the place of the protagonist?" or "What conclusions from this story are important to you?" The language ceases to be just a subject. It becomes a tool for expressing your own "I," which radically changes the attitude towards the subject and forms a stable personality-oriented motivation.

To increase motivation to learn a foreign language, it is important to select books that are appropriate for the age and interests of students. For example, Roald Dahl's fairy tales "Charlie and the Chocolate Factory" or "Alice's Adventures in Wonderland" Lewis Carroll will be interesting for elementary school students, then for adolescent’s literature is needed that resonates with the psychological features of this age. If the text answers the student's internal requests or simply falls into the sphere of his hobbies (sports, music, fashion, science), learning the language turns from a duty into a hobby, for example J. K. Rowling “Harry Potter”.

The psychological moment is also very important, like the growth of autonomy and overcoming the challenge. Successfully reading an unadopted text is a victory over complexity. Correctly selected text (methodologists advise using the principle of "understandable entry" when the material is a little more complicated than the current level) creates a zone of closest development. Students may not understand every word, but capture the general meaning, and then, returning to the text, deepen their understanding of the details [5]. This develops language guesswork and autonomy - the ability to learn on your own. The feeling of "I was able to read and understand it" is a powerful motivator.

The use of authentic texts in foreign language lessons has a number of advantages:

1. increasing student motivation.

2. extension of vocabulary.

3. Familiarity with culture.

4. Development of critical thinking.

Despite the obvious advantages, the use of authentic texts requires a well-thought-out methodology from the teacher and careful preparation in several stages:

1. Pre-reading: Removing lexical difficulties, activating background knowledge, creating interest before reading.

2. While-reading: Tasks for global and selective understanding, using keys for self-control.

3. Post-reading: Moving from understanding to discussing, debating, role-playing, writing essays and creating projects.

Authentic materials can contain complex constructions, unfamiliar cultural realities and various dialects, which requires careful selection by the teacher.

Thus, reading authentic literature is an effective means of increasing motivation to learn a foreign language. Studies of foreign and Kazakhstani scientists confirm that the integration of authentic texts into the educational process contributes to the growth of internal motivation due to:

- increase the reliability of information and interest in it;

- emotional involvement;

- development of critical thinking and personal growth;

- building a sense of success and autonomy.

The inclusion of authentic literature in the educational process provides students with access to a real language through literature, they receive not only knowledge, but also a powerful incentive to continue this exciting path - the path of discovering the world through the prism of another language.
